File Formats: A Quick Breakdown for Your Workflow
Understanding the deliverables ensures you can use them immediately without technical hiccups:
- Transparent PNG: Best for quick mockups, presentations (PowerPoint/Keynote), and social media posts where you need to layer the image over a background color or photo.
- SVG File: Essential for web developers. It is code-based, scalable, and lightweight, ensuring your website performance remains high.
- EPS 10 & AI Editable: The industry standard for print designers. These ensure that whether you are printing a massive banner or a small business card, the edges remain crisp and the colors accurate.
